PSG-Saint-Etienne: the ratings of Parisian players

2020-01-08T22:53:24.417Z


The player on loan from Inter Milan scored his first hat-trick in Paris in the quarter-final victory in the League Cup (6-1).


As expected, Thomas Tuchel aligned his best team of the moment. With a new offensive recital to the key led by his quartet composed of Di Maria, Neymar, Mbappé and Icardi, involved in the six goals of his team against ASSE (6-1).

Rico: 6. The Spanish goalkeeper postponed his second penalty in four days, but could not do anything about the recovery of Cabaye (71st). For the rest, it was little used but effective.

Meunier: 6. The Belgian slid the ball in timing to launch Icardi and PSG on the right track (2nd). His second assist of the season at the start of a problem-free match.

Marquinhos: 6. Some errors in the fiber of a recovery match, such as a poor recovery (6th), a missed cross (18th) or a curiously conceded corner (35th). Very easy then.

Kehrer: 4. The German defender is not very reassuring when he has the ball in his feet. He lost too many balls and often seemed to the limit before the Greens play ten, despite his desire to go forward.

Bernat: 5.5. In this configuration, it is less offensive than usual. He could have scored a goal after a fantastic sequence involving Neymar, Mbappé and Gueye, but his shot largely fled the frame (19th).

Di Maria: 7.5. The Argentinian has done everything: he is involved in three goals caused the Stéphanois expulsion then conceded a penalty. He first offered a perfect assist to Neymar, with incredible freedom full axis (39th). He was then the last Parisian to touch the ball on the 3rd goal, before ... three Stéphanois and a post. He also recovered the ball from 4th goal. Replaced by Draxler (81st).

Gueye: 6. In the leg, despite some unsuccessful passes. It drives the action of the opening of the score.

Verratti: 5.5. In this 4-4-2, Verratti is confined to a fairly defensive role. He did quite well even if at 11 against 11, he sometimes had trouble filling the gaps when his attacking teammates were less attentive on the folds. Replaced by Paredes (72nd).

Neymar: 7. Several double contacts and some delicious exchanges with Mbappé with whom he often stayed close. He scored with a dive ball full of touch (39th). It still lacks juice after the holidays but already hurts.

Icardi: 9. The Argentine goleador scored on his first touch of the ball with a strike from the bull. He waited for his second ball of the second period to double the bet with a balanced volley (49th) before offering his first Parisian hat-trick, still in fox. He has 17 goals in 19 games in Paris and that's not all. His control of tiptoe in extension and his decisive pass to Mbappé on the next ball is a masterpiece. Replaced by Cavani (72nd).

Mbappé: 8. The attacker had juice. His rake sequence - passes from the flat of the foot behind the support leg on the 3rd goal is a treat. He was a decisive passer on the 4th and 5th goals, where he did all the work for Icardi (49th and 59th), before scoring himself (67th).
